How this is calculated

Blocks = wall face area / block face area, plus waste, rounded up. Caps assume 12 in units, one per foot of wall. Base gravel fills a 12 in wide x 6 in deep trench; drainage backfill assumes a 12 in wide column of gravel the full height of the wall.

Enter the wall's length and exposed height, pick your block size, and this calculator counts the blocks and caps plus the two gravel quantities every segmental wall needs: a compacted base under the first course and free-draining backfill behind the wall. Blocks are counted by face area, so the math works for any running-bond pattern.

One course of blocks should also be buried below grade for every 8 inches of exposed height (minimum one course), which the waste factor helps cover on short walls. Anything over 3 to 4 feet tall, or supporting a slope or driveway above it, moves out of DIY territory: most codes require an engineered design and a permit at that point.

Blocks for common wall sizes

Rows use 12 x 4 in blocks with 10% extra for the buried course and cuts.

Wall sizeBlocksCapsBackfill
10 ft long x 1.5 ft tall50 blocks10 caps0.56 cu yd
20 ft x 2 ft134 blocks20 caps1.48 cu yd
30 ft x 2 ft200 blocks30 caps2.22 cu yd
40 ft x 3 ft400 blocks40 caps4.44 cu yd
50 ft x 3 ft500 blocks50 caps5.56 cu yd

Common questions

How many retaining wall blocks per square foot?

Divide by the block's face area: the common 12 x 4 inch garden wall block covers a third of a square foot, so it takes three per square foot of wall face. A 16 x 6 inch block covers two thirds of a square foot, about 1.5 per square foot.

Does the first course really need to be buried?

Yes. Bury at least one full course, or about 10% of the wall height for taller walls, on a compacted gravel base. The buried course locks the wall's toe so soil pressure cannot kick the bottom forward, and skipping it is the most common cause of leaning garden walls.

What goes behind a retaining wall?

A column of clean crushed gravel at least 12 inches deep, ideally with a perforated drain pipe at the base sloped to daylight. Water, not soil, pushes walls over: saturated backfill roughly doubles the pressure, and the gravel plus pipe give it a way out.

How tall can I build without an engineer?

Most manufacturers rate their standard blocks for gravity walls up to 3 or 4 feet in good conditions, and many codes require permits and engineering above 4 feet measured from the bottom of the footing. Slopes, driveways, or fences above the wall lower that threshold, so check locally before building tall.
